What is the chassis code of the BMW 5 Series?

The chassis code of the BMW 5 Series is G30, while the extended wheelbase version has the chassis code G38. The domestic 5 Series is a premium sedan with body dimensions of 4998 mm in length, 1901 mm in width, and 1559 mm in height. The BMW 5 Series features a double-wishbone independent front suspension and a multi-link independent rear suspension. It is equipped with a 3.0-liter inline six-cylinder turbocharged engine, coded as N55B30A, delivering a maximum power of 225 kW and a maximum torque of 400 Nm. The engine reaches its peak power at 5800 to 6000 rpm and its peak torque at 1200 to 5000 rpm. This engine incorporates BMW's Double VANOS and Valvetronic technologies, uses an aluminum alloy cylinder head and block, and is paired with an 8-speed automatic transmission.

How Often Should the Throttle Body Be Cleaned?

The throttle body generally needs to be cleaned every 20,000 to 40,000 kilometers. The throttle body is a controllable valve that regulates the airflow entering the engine. After the air enters the intake manifold, it mixes with gasoline to form a combustible mixture, which then burns to generate power. The throttle body is connected to the air filter at the top and the engine block at the bottom, often referred to as the "throat" of the car engine. The cleaning method for the throttle body is as follows: 1. Use a flat-head screwdriver to loosen the fastening screws of the metal clamp connecting the air filter and the throttle body, separating the air filter cover from the throttle body; 2. For cleaning an electronic throttle body, it is best to have two people operate—one responsible for pressing the accelerator and the other for cleaning. Spray carburetor cleaner onto a clean cloth and then carefully wipe the throttle body clean; 3. After cleaning, check whether the throttle body is thoroughly cleaned and whether it can open and close freely. Then reconnect the air filter to the throttle body, ensuring a proper seal, and tighten the screws of the metal clamp. If any sensor connectors were removed, reattach them.

What is the process for replacing the battery in a BMW key?

BMW key battery replacement process is: 1. First identify the battery model for your car key, which will be specified in the vehicle owner's manual, then select a new key battery according to the specified model; 2. Remove the hidden mechanical key from the remote; 3. Using the extracted mechanical key, insert it into the key slot and pry open the key casing; 4. After opening the key casing, you'll find the battery positioned deep inside - use a flat tool to slide along the side gaps and gently pry out the old battery; 5. When installing the new battery, ensure correct polarity (positive/negative terminals), then snap the back cover in place to complete the battery replacement. Finally, reinsert the mechanical key. Is the Battery of Toyota Vios Maintenance-Free?

Toyota Vios's battery is not maintenance-free. The functions of the battery are: 1. Provide starting current to the starter when starting the engine; 2. Assist the generator in supplying power to electrical equipment when the generator is overloaded; 3. Supply power to electrical equipment when the engine is idling; 4. Protect the car's electrical appliances; 5. Convert part of the electrical energy into chemical energy for storage when the generator's terminal voltage is higher than the electromotive force of the lead-acid battery. The dimensions of the Toyota Vios are: length 4435mm, width 1700mm, height 1490mm, wheelbase 2550mm, minimum ground clearance 160mm, fuel tank capacity 42 liters, and body weight 1070kg.

Is the Festa equipped with a dry dual-clutch transmission?

The Festa is equipped with a dry dual-clutch transmission. The method to distinguish between dry and wet dual-clutch transmissions is to check whether the friction plates of the dual-clutch contain lubricating oil. Taking the 2021 Festa as an example, it belongs to the compact car category, with body dimensions of: length 4660mm, width 1790mm, height 1425mm, wheelbase of 2700mm, fuel tank capacity of 53l, trunk capacity of 475l, and curb weight of 1365kg. The 2021 Festa is powered by a 1.6T turbocharged engine, delivering a maximum horsepower of 204PS, maximum power of 150kW, maximum torque of 265Nm, and is paired with a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ission.

What is the fuel tank capacity of the Toyota Sienna?

The fuel tank capacity of the Toyota Sienna is 75 liters. The Toyota Sienna is a mid-to-large-sized MPV under the Toyota Group. Taking the 2011 two-wheel-drive automatic Toyota Sienna as an example, its body dimensions are: length 5085mm, width 1983mm, height 1811mm, with a wheelbase of 3030mm. The 2011 two-wheel-drive automatic Toyota Sienna features a front suspension with MacPherson independent suspension and a stabilizer bar, and a rear suspension with a torsion beam non-independent suspension. It is equipped with a 2.7L naturally aspirated engine, delivering a maximum horsepower of 190PS, a maximum power of 139kW, and a maximum torque of 253Nm.
